Today was an awesome day!  We were blessed to be a part of the third annual Trucks for Charity (TFC3) hosted at New Life Church by Matt and Hannah Hazelwood, Kyle Pelletier, and Brittany DiFusco.  The day started out frosty but warmed up quickly, and the lot was packed! Grills and fryers were going with food, DJ playing country faves, all kinds of trucks, excavators and more for the kids to try out. We met and spent time with the families who were sponsored by TFC for the first and second years.  Naaman’s clinic buddies Savannah and Cole also came out.  I think it’s the first time they have been together not only outdoors but also without being hooked up to lines of any kind!
